I can't seem to pop the bubble with any arrow. It's the one below the first jump ramp near the beginning of the dungeon.


Also, at 5:30AM, before dawn of the next day, my screen goes black and never comes back. I am still in control of Link, but I can't see anything. Even when dawn supposedly passes, the screen stays black. I end up having to fast-forward time using the ocarina before 5:30AM to prevent it from happening.

#1 - There is a wall blocking it. You have to shoot from a certain location, i'm not sure offhand where that location is, but it's somewhere you can get to in that room without issue the first time.
#2 - Known issue. Glide64 has (hack) fixed it. I think that's the only emulator where that issue doesn't occur. There are 2 solutions:
A - Use Glide64. (Glide64 3.1WIP is the last playable version if you are not using a voodoo card (and hence using eVoodoo.) Unlike the previous versions (which didn't have this option,) in order for 3.1WIP to be playable (if you are using eVoodoo) you must set Buffer Mode from Z-Buffer (default) to W-Buffer in the Glide64 options.
B - Right before 5:30 play the song of double time to skip that half hour and go straight to start of the next day. There is no point worrying about the wasted half hour, as you can't do anything blindly anyway. Pausing is useless, as the time won't pass. Be sure not to get caught in a situation like that with enemies nearby! You can always play the song of double time AFTER the screen goes black if you have the ocarina already set to a C-Button.
